A COMPANY at the centre of last year's National Broadband Network roll-out asbestos scandal in Ballarat has been found guilty of two charges and ordered to pay more than $20,000.
POLICE
A 19-year-old man was hit by a car while running from Protective Services Officers at Ballarat station on Thursday afternoon.
The man ran down the Mair Street ramp at the station and into traffic, after reportedly being found with spray paint, when he was struck by a Holden Commodore heading towards Lydiard Street just after 5pm.
FIRE
Crews attended a car that was leaking gas in Ballarat East just before 8pm on Thursday night.
Luckily, the occupant of the vehicle had isolated the leak before crews arrived on scene.
Crews also attended a false alarm when a faulty smoke detector went off in Ballarat East at 2am.
